Bentonite clay, also called volcanic ash, is a naturally occurring mineral deposit found all over the world. Clay has been used in skin care for ages; the bentonite variant is rich in montmorillonite, making it thicker and more absorbent than the rest. Bentonite clay carries a negative charge and works by sticking to elements with a positive charge — like toxins, bacteria and fungi — and getting rid of them from the surface of your skin.
